我在web.config中有以下内容

<sessionState cookieName="ASP.NET_SessionId" cookieless="false" mode="InProc" timeout="1" regenerateExpiredSessionId="true"/>


但是,在1分钟后,会话将不会过期。
是什么原因造成的?

谢谢

最佳答案

我假设您正在使用表单身份验证。默认情况下,滑动到期为true,因此,如果您查看web.config表单元素的slideExpiration属性,则可能会得到所需的行为。如果为false,它将在设置后的指定时间后过期。

看到:

http://msdn.microsoft.com/en-us/library/1d3t3c61.aspx

关于asp.net - ASP.NET session 不会过期,我们在Stack Overflow上找到一个类似的问题:https://stackoverflow.com/questions/3343269/

10-13 08:00